More iPhone Price Cuts Ahead of New Model’s Launch

Various models of Apple’s iPhone continue to see sporadic discounts at retailers, ahead of what is expected to be the announcement of a new model next month.

Target is offering the Verizon and AT&T flavors of the iPhone 4S for $179, while Best Buy has shaved $50 off the eight gigabyte iPhone 4, selling that model for just $49.

Those price drops join a promotion from Sprint, which is currently selling the iPhone 4S for $149, $50 less than its usual price.

Apple stores are also quietly matching prices from these and other retailers, according to a Wall Street Journal story.

Apple is expected to announce a new fall product lineup, including the next iPhone, at an event the week of Sept. 9.
